Understanding the Importance of Lockouts
Before diving into the specifics of installation, it’s important to understand why lockout devices are necessary. Lockout procedures are designed to isolate electrical energy sources and prevent machines or electrical circuits from being unintentionally energized during maintenance work. This practice is part of a broader safety protocol known as Lockout/Tagout (LOTO), which mandates that machinery and electrical systems must be properly shut down and locked to avoid accidental operation.
The proper use of electrical equipment lockouts helps to protect workers from the dangers associated with electrical energy, such as electrocution, burns, or even fatalities. Moreover, it ensures compliance with workplace safety regulations, like those outlined by OSHA (Occupational Safety and Health Administration).
